# HG changeset patch # User Josef Eisl # Date 1441640319 -7200 # Node ID 9fd19e2fc0be34c4ea12d74c449746d486249e76 # Parent b3c4b69bc71fd32fc007133cb1740f771a06d588 TraceRA: TraceLinearScanLifetimeAnalysisPhase: higher dump level for intermediate interval dumps. diff -r b3c4b69bc71f -r 9fd19e2fc0be graal/com.oracle.graal.lir/src/com/oracle/graal/lir/alloc/trace/TraceLinearScanLifetimeAnalysisPhase.java --- a/graal/com.oracle.graal.lir/src/com/oracle/graal/lir/alloc/trace/TraceLinearScanLifetimeAnalysisPhase.java Tue Sep 08 14:18:54 2015 +0200 +++ b/graal/com.oracle.graal.lir/src/com/oracle/graal/lir/alloc/trace/TraceLinearScanLifetimeAnalysisPhase.java Mon Sep 07 17:38:39 2015 +0200 @@ -59,6 +59,7 @@ final class TraceLinearScanLifetimeAnalysisPhase extends AllocationPhase { + private static final int DUMP_DURING_ANALYSIS_LEVEL = 4; protected final TraceLinearScan allocator; private final TraceBuilderResult traceBuilderResult; @@ -877,7 +878,9 @@ } // end of instruction iteration } - allocator.printIntervals("After Block " + block); + if (Debug.isDumpEnabled(DUMP_DURING_ANALYSIS_LEVEL)) { + allocator.printIntervals("After Block " + block); + } } // end of block iteration // fix spill state for phi/sigma intervals